Post Offices nearby NHSP Plaza, A.K.M. Fazl-ul-Haq Road, Islamabad 44000, Pakistan

Pakistan Post - 63 St

Approximately 0.85 km away
Address: 63 St, Islamabad, Pakistan

Post Office G-7 Markaz

Approximately 1.26 km away
Address: Sachal Sarmast Rd, Islamabad, Pakistan

Pakistan Post Mall

Approximately 1.49 km away
Address: F-7 Markaz, Islamabad, Pakistan